To comprehend the profound impact of a Level 2 Electrician, one need Level 2 Electricians in Sydney to initially value the structure of our electrical distribution system. Think of a huge, invisible river of power, stemming from enormous generators and snaking its way through high-voltage transmission lines. Before this powerful current can securely enter your home, it undergoes a series of changes and dispatches, a complicated process handled by a network operator. It's at the important junction where this network meets your residential or commercial property that the Level 2 Electrician steps in.

Unlike a general electrician who generally manages the circuitry within a structure, a Level 2 professional is authorized to deal with the service mains-- the cables that link your facilities to the overhead or underground network. This encompasses a broad spectrum of vital tasks, ranging from the installation of brand-new service lines to the repair work of broken ones. Consider a newly constructed home requiring to be linked to the grid; it's the Level 2 Electrician who deftly manages the overhead service cables or expertly lays the underground channels to facilitate this necessary link. Similarly, if a storm downs a power line resulting in your residential or commercial property, it's often these professionals who are dispatched to safely reconnect you.

Their proficiency extends beyond mere connection. They are the go-to specialists for metering options, responsible for the installation, relocation, and even replacement of electricity meters. With the increasing adoption of smart meters and progressing billing systems, their function in ensuring accurate power consumption information is more crucial than ever. Additionally, Level 2 Electricians are licensed to disconnect and reconnect supply to residential or commercial properties, a vital service during upgrades, renovations, or for security reasons. This fragile operation requires an intimate understanding of safety protocols and a precise approach to avoid disruptions or threats to the broader community.

The strenuous training and stringent licensing requirements for these specialists underscore the gravity of their obligations. Ending up being a Level 2 Electrician involves not simply extensive useful experience as a certified basic electrician, however also specialized training modules that look into network safety, high-voltage procedures, and specific cabling techniques. They should show an extensive understanding of the national circuitry rules and the particular service and installation guidelines determined by the network operators. This specific understanding is vital, as their work straight affects the integrity and safety of the entire electrical grid.
